Gerda is a ten-year-old Norwegian girl with a very big imagination. With her apron-cape and a wooden sword, Gerda spends her days acting out the adventures of Porthos and “The Three Musketeers,” annoying her brother Otto in the process. But when her parents are arrested by German soldiers for hiding Jewish children, Gerda embarks on her own heroic adventure—not as Porthos, but as herself. With her parents gone, it is up to Gerda to help young Sarah and Daniel hide from the Nazis and escape into unoccupied Sweden. Otto, who has been misled into sympathizing with the Nazis, begrudgingly joins his sister on her quest to save their new friends and proves himself to be a hero in his own right. As the four children journey across the Norwegian wilderness, they face many dangers along the way. But when they stick together, they discover they can overcome them all. An incredible story of friendship, bravery, and doing what’s right, THE CROSSING is a compelling film the whole family can enjoy. (In Norwegian with subtitles) — G.S.
